1

Тема: Як вирахувати мережевий префікс?

Наприклад дана адреса 172.20.35.123/20. Як зрозуміли, що префікс саме 20, а не 15?
Як тут виходячи з цього вирахувати маску підмережі?

2

Re: Як вирахувати мережевий префікс?

11111111 11111111 11110000 00000000 - 20 одиничок
255 255 а далі рахуємо

1 = 1
10 = 2
100 = 4
1000 = 8
10000 = 16
100000 = 32
1000000 = 64
10000000 = 128

тоді 11110000 - це 128 + 64 + 32 + 16 = 240
, одже, маска 255.255.240.0

Подякували: leofun01, andriesko2

3

Re: Як вирахувати мережевий префікс?

11111111 11111111 11110000 00000000
Перші 2 октети зрозуміло, а звідки взяли 2 останні?

4

Re: Як вирахувати мережевий префікс?

бо префікс 20 означає 20 одиничок, а маска складається з 32 одиничок, от записуєте 20 одиничок, а решта буде нулями, ділите це все на 4, аби вийшло 4 по 8, і переводете кожен октет в десяткову систему

5

Re: Як вирахувати мережевий префікс?

Добре, а якби я просто вам сказав би 172.20.35.123. Тобто без префіксу, як би ви його знайшли?

6

Re: Як вирахувати мережевий префікс?

ніяк, певно що

Подякували: koala, leofun01, LoganRoss3

7

Re: Як вирахувати мережевий префікс?

pumpkin написав:

Наприклад дана адреса 172.20.35.123/20. Як зрозуміли, що префікс саме 20, а не 15?

Дуже просто - подивитися на число після дробу. Якщо там 20, то префікс 20. А якщо 15, то 15.

Подякували: leofun01, LoganRoss, FakiNyan3

8 Востаннє редагувалося pumpkin (17.06.2018 19:54:31)

Re: Як вирахувати мережевий префікс?

koala написав:
pumpkin написав:

Наприклад дана адреса 172.20.35.123/20. Як зрозуміли, що префікс саме 20, а не 15?

Дуже просто - подивитися на число після дробу. Якщо там 20, то префікс 20. А якщо 15, то 15.

Яка маска буде в адреси 116.41.0.0??

9

Re: Як вирахувати мережевий префікс?

pumpkin написав:

Яка маска буде в адреси 116.41.0.0??

Відкрийте налаштування мережі на своєму комп'ютері, вкладинку, де IPv4. Бачите окреме поле "маска"? Як гадаєте, якби його можна було однозначно обчислювати, то хіба просили б користувача її ввести?

10

Re: Як вирахувати мережевий префікс?

koala написав:
pumpkin написав:

Яка маска буде в адреси 116.41.0.0??

Відкрийте налаштування мережі на своєму комп'ютері, вкладинку, де IPv4. Бачите окреме поле "маска"? Як гадаєте, якби його можна було однозначно обчислювати, то хіба просили б користувача її ввести?

До чого ця відповідь? Я вирішую задачі, які мені задали. Оскільки адреса відноситься до класу А, то іі маска має бути 255.0.0.0, однак онлайн перевіряючи мені видає 255.255.255.0.

11

Re: Як вирахувати мережевий префікс?

Класові мережі закінчилися в 1993 році, гадаю, до вашого народження.
Ну і "онлайн перевірка" - це з серії "на паркані написано". Конкретно - який сайт?

12

Re: Як вирахувати мережевий префікс?

Якщо вас цікавить не абстрактно, а конкретно, кому належать ці адреси і як розподілені, то:
http://www.iana.org/assignments/ipv4-ad … pace.xhtml

116/8    APNIC    2007-01    whois.apnic.net    https://rdap.apnic.net/    ALLOCATED    

https://wq.apnic.net/static/search.html

inetnum:    116.32.0.0 - 116.47.255.255
netname:    Xpeed
descr:    LG POWERCOMM
admin-c:    IM669-AP
tech-c:    IM669-AP
country:    KR
status:    ALLOCATED PORTABLE
mnt-by:    MNT-KRNIC-AP
mnt-irt:    IRT-KRNIC-KR
last-modified:    2017-02-02T01:32:06Z
source:    APNIC

Далі я не знаю, як 116.32.0.0/12 розподілена, вибачте.

Подякували: leofun011